Duties Prepare treatment rooms with dental instruments, supplies, and equipment, ensuring proper sterilization and aseptic techniques in accordance with infection prevention management policies. Assist dentists chairside during a variety of procedures including general dentistry, oral surgery, endodontics, prosthodontics, and pediatric dentistry. Take and develop dental radiographs (X-ray), including dental x-ray imaging and 3D scans using advanced medical imaging technology. Manage patient records accurately within electronic medical records (EMR) systems such as Eaglesoft or Dentrix, ensuring compliance with HIPAA regulations for confidentiality. Perform vital signs assessment and document medical documentation to support comprehensive patient care. Educate patients on oral health practices, post-treatment care, and treatment plans while maintaining excellent patient management software records. Support dental sterilization procedures and instrument processing to uphold the highest standards of infection control and dental equipment maintenance. Assist with dental instrument processing, dental sterilization procedures, and maintaining clinical cleanliness in accordance with healthcare infection prevention and control expertise. Collaborate seamlessly with the dental team through four-handed dentistry techniques to optimize clinical workflow and patient comfort. What they do
A Dental Assistant assists dentists in caring for patient's teeth. Helps patients get ready for treatment; prepares equipment and supplies. May perform some dental procedures under the direction of a dentist, such as fluoride application, if allowed under state regulations. Works in dental offices.
